- GERRY AND THE PACEMAKERS.
Gerry is a living legend. He is a local hero and his version of "You never walk alone" from Carousel is synonymous with Liverpool Fotball Fanclub and has become a football antheem the world over.
Gerry was the second most successful Merseybeat band after The Fabs. Among songs he wrote was "Ferry cross the Mersey" which has spawned a whole tourist industry in Liverpool by itself. |
